Salads, which include various seafood, are very popular both in restaurants and cafes, and during home feasts. They earned such recognition due to their pleasant taste and easy digestibility of the ingredients. And the preparation of sea salad takes very little time.

You will need

    • any seafood (shrimp
    • squid
    • mussels
    • octopuses, etc.) - 500 g or 1 pack of frozen sea cocktail;
    • salmon roe;
    • onions - half a large head;
    • eggs - 3 pcs.;
    • olives - 20 pcs.;
    • Bulgarian pepper (red) - 1 pc.;
    • hard cheese (parmesan) - 150 g;
    • curly parsley;
    • leaf lettuce;
    • olive oil;
    • lemon - 1/2 pcs.;
    • salt
    • pepper;
    • balsamic vinegar - 10 ml.;
    • flower pots or bowls - according to the required number of servings.

Instruction manual

1

Pour 2 liters of water into the pan and bring to a boil. Throw seafood into boiling salted water to taste and cook for no more than 10 minutes. Thawing them before this is not necessary.

2

Put the eggs for 10-15 minutes.

3

While seafood is cooked, wash and chop onions and peppers in half rings 2-3 mm thick, olives - along into thin strips. Put everything in a salad bowl

4

Flip ready-made seafood in a colander so that all the water glass. Pour boiled eggs with cold water.

5

Cut the eggs into strips. Cut large seafood (squid - thin half rings), leave the rest whole. Add eggs and seafood to a bowl of pepper and onions. Mix well.

6

Cooking salad dressing. Squeeze the juice from half a lemon and mix it with vinegar, add salt and pepper to taste. Stir continuously, pour this mixture into a thin stream of olive oil. Season the salad.

7

Grate the parmesan on a fine grater.

8

Place 1-2 lettuce leaves on the bottom of each flowerpot, put a small amount of lettuce on top. Garnish each serving with red eggs and parsley leaves and sprinkle with cheese.

note

Salt the water intended for cooking seafood purely symbolically - remember that salad dressing will also contain salt.

Seafood can easily be poisoned. This is due to the fact that the storage conditions of such goods were violated in a warehouse or store (for example, it was unfrozen for some reason, and then was again frozen). When buying frozen seafood, pay attention to their appearance - a qualitatively frozen and properly stored product should not be a "whole block of ice." Do not forget to check the expiration date of the goods.

Useful advice

The taste of the salad will be softer if you use white salad or red sweet onions as an ingredient. If you bought the whole carcasses of squid, then before cooking they should first be thawed, cleaned from the insides and rinse well. If you want the sea salad to be more satisfying, make a dressing of mayonnaise and lemon juice.
